What Is the Bihar Student Credit Card Scheme (BSCC)?
The Bihar Student Credit Card Scheme (BSCC) is a government-supported education loan initiative for students who are permanent residents of Bihar.
Key points students must know:
- Education loan support up to ₹4 lakh
- Interest is paid by the Bihar Government
- The loan must be repaid by the student
- Valid only for approved courses and institutions
- Final approval happens after district-level verification
📌 Important clarity:
BSCC is a loan, not a scholarship and not free education.

Can Bihar Students Use BSCC at MATS University?
Short answer: Yes — conditionally
Bihar students can apply for BSCC while studying at MATS University if all eligibility conditions are met.
Eligibility depends on:
- ✔ Student being a permanent resident of Bihar
- ✔ The chosen course being approved under BSCC
- ✔ A provisional admission letter from MATS University
- ✔ Successful district-level document verification
⚠️ Final approval is given by BSCC authorities, not by:
- The university
- Counsellors
- Admission agents
Step-by-Step: Using Bihar Student Credit Card at MATS University
Step 1: Choose the Course Carefully
Before applying anywhere:
- Match the course with career scope
- Understand the total duration
- Confirm whether the course is BSCC-eligible
📌 Course choice affects both career outcomes and EMI pressure later.
Step 2: Get a Provisional Admission Letter
Students must apply to MATS University and obtain a provisional admission letter.
This letter is required to:
- Apply for BSCC
- Start document verification
Without this, the loan process cannot move forward.
Step 3: Apply Online for BSCC
Students then apply through the official BSCC portal and submit:
- Academic certificates
- Residence proof
- Admission letter
- Course and fee details
Accuracy is important — small mistakes cause delays.
Step 4: Attend District-Level Verification
This is a mandatory step.
During verification:
- Documents are checked physically
- Course eligibility is reviewed
- Loan amount suitability is assessed
📌 Many delays happen due to incomplete documents — preparation matters.
Step 5: Loan Approval & Disbursement
If approved:
- Loan is sanctioned (up to ₹4 lakh)
- Amount is disbursed as per government timelines
- Students can proceed with final admission steps
⏳ Timelines vary by district, so patience is required.
What Costs Does BSCC Actually Cover?
Usually Covered:
- Tuition fees (within loan limit)
- Some hostel or mess charges (often capped)
- Admission or examination fees (case-by-case)
Usually NOT Covered:
- Travel and transportation
- Personal expenses
- Study materials beyond limits
- Any amount above ₹4 lakh
Example:
If total cost = ₹5.5 lakh
BSCC covers = ₹4 lakh
👉 Student/family must plan the ₹1.5 lakh gap
